text: Charles Richard Cross was an American music journalist, author and editor who was based in Seattle. He documented the Seattle music scene as the editor of The Rocket in Seattle from 1986–2000. Cross wrote three New York Times bestselllers, including the award-winning 2001 biography of Kurt Cobain, Heavier Than Heaven, and Room Full of Mirrors: A Biography of Jimi Hendrix, which Vibe described as "one of the greatest-ever books on music".
